What is the Intimation Letter
An intimation letter is a formal communication used to notify an individual or organization about a specific event or action. This letter serves various purposes, such as informing someone about a decision, confirming an appointment, or providing updates on a process. It is essential in both personal and professional contexts, ensuring that the recipient is adequately informed. The meaning of the intimation letter can vary depending on the context in which it is used, but its primary function remains the same: to convey important information clearly and concisely.
Key Elements of the Intimation Letter
When drafting an intimation letter, several key elements should be included to ensure clarity and effectiveness. These elements typically consist of:
- Sender's Information: The name, address, and contact details of the individual or organization sending the letter.
- Date: The date the letter is written, which helps establish a timeline.
- Recipient's Information: The name and address of the person or organization receiving the letter.
- Subject Line: A brief statement indicating the purpose of the letter.
- Body: The main content of the letter, detailing the information being conveyed.
- Closing: A polite closing statement, followed by the sender's signature and printed name.

Legal Use of the Intimation Letter
The legal use of an intimation letter can be significant, particularly in business and contractual contexts. It may serve as a formal record of communication between parties, which can be important in legal disputes. For an intimation letter to be considered legally binding, it must meet certain criteria, such as being clear, concise, and properly formatted. Additionally, the letter should be sent through a reliable method that provides proof of delivery, ensuring that the recipient cannot dispute receipt of the information.
Examples of Using the Intimation Letter
Intimation letters can be utilized in various scenarios, showcasing their versatility. Common examples include:
- Job Offer: A company may send an intimation letter to inform a candidate about their job offer.
- Appointment Confirmation: A healthcare provider may use an intimation letter to confirm an appointment with a patient.
- Event Notification: Organizations may send out intimation letters to notify stakeholders about upcoming events or changes in policy.
